    posted this on the main board but figured one of you guys might be able to help me out

    i looked through the searches and found nothing so if this is answered somewhere else im sorry

    I have a 53 mainiline with a straight six, 3 on the tree, i just picked up a 8ba out of another 53 ford. It came with a fordomatic. Will the 3spd behind the six bolt up and work with out any extra parts?

    At the very least you'll need the correct flywheel and clutch ***embly, pilot bearing, throwout bearing, clutch linkage for both sides of the firewall, and a bunch of ***orted hardware.

    You may want to check this place out:http://www.owenssalvage.com/alliance.html they have a lot of Fords from that era.Good news is your Ford-O-Matic pedals and linkage will work in a 52-56 Ford so if someone is doing a 302 & C4 or AOD swap you can resell your parts,you have two options you could swap in a stick shift column from a 52-54 Ford which is a pain or use a Spectre floor shift on the 3 speed about $40 from Jegs or Summit.The other part for the swap you'll need is the Z-bar and bracket from a 52-53 V8 car.
